English: Sanamahi Laikan Puya - Classical Meitei language manuscript text - in traditional Meetei Mayek writing system - One of the holy & sacred scriptures of traditional Meetei ethnic religion (Sanamahi religion / Sanamahism / Lainingthou religion / Lainingthouism / Kanglei religion / Kangleism / Meeteism / Meiteism) of Ancient Kangleipak civilization state (Early Manipur realm)
